1305220633336 has 16 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 2447309100600. Its totient is φ = 652604873184.

The previous prime is 1305220633309. The next prime is 1305220633357. The reversal of 1305220633336 is 6333360225031.

It is a junction number, because it is equal to n+sod(n) for n = 1305220633295 and 1305220633304.

It is a congruent number.

It is an unprimeable number.

It is a pernicious number, because its binary representation contains a prime number (23) of ones.

It is a polite number, since it can be written in 3 ways as a sum of consecutive naturals, for example, 448866 + ... + 1676878.

Almost surely, 21305220633336 is an apocalyptic number.

It is an amenable number.

1305220633336 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(1142088467264).

1305220633336 is a wasteful number, since it uses less digits than its factorization.

1305220633336 is an odious number, because the sum of its binary digits is odd.

The sum of its prime factors is 1360878 (or 1360874 counting only the distinct ones).

The product of its (nonzero) digits is 174960, while the sum is 37.

Adding to 1305220633336 its reverse (6333360225031), we get a palindrome (7638580858367).
